文摘After almost fifteen years, we remind our fellow scientists of the Stochastic process, a natural mechanism for obtaining the Shroud Body Image. The above process is considered the only source of energy present in an ancient tomb: the thermal one emitted by the corpse of Jesus Christ. It, for all corpses, is notoriously so weak that the only process that could be triggered is the Stochastic one. However, the best-known expert scientists in the Shroud of Turin investigation did not take this model into account, even if it guaranteed a latent image, typical of the Stochastic process, and a fibrils distribution as appears on the Shroud surface. The above scientists and many others had already chosen the Radiative hypothesis, which is based on the emission of radiation (Ultraviolet) and nuclear particles (Protons and Neutrons) by the corpse of Jesus Christ. These emissions are impossible;conversely, if they were true, we would have to talk about miracles. Today, after four decades, it would be appropriate to accept that the Radiative hypothesis (which in the Turin Shroud case becomes a miraculous hypothesis) cannot be in line with both Physics and Theology. We think that we should all be more fiscal when we judge our work.
